AmaKhosi Safari Lodge is situated in the 12,000 hectare Amazulu Private Game Reserve, just over 3 hours north of Durban. The reserve is made up of a varied ecosystem which includes savanna, mountains and wetlands – making it the ideal home to the Big 5 as well as giraffe, warthog and hyena, hippopotamus and crocodile. Thanda Private Game Reserve, in northern KwaZulu-Natal, has taken top honours at the 15th annual World Travel Awards. At the glittering ceremony held in Durban last night, Thanda won esteemed awards for ‘South Africa’s Leading Safari Lodge’, and ‘Africa’s Leading Luxury Lodge’ for the 3rd consecutive year.
